combobox!!!!(100分)

  • 主题发起人 主题发起人 ATY
  • 开始时间 开始时间
A

ATY

Unregistered / Unconfirmed
GUEST, unregistred user!
combobox的style属性已经设置成为csDropDownList,(只读)
在items里已经输入了1,2,3,4,5。
但是在Form的show事件里面,系统每次会随机产生这5个数中的一个,我要把产生的这个数字在combobox中显示出来,请问应该如何实现?谢谢!
 
假设随机数=4:
I := ComboBox1.Items.IndexOf('4');
If I <> -1 then

ComboBox1.ItemIndex := I;
 
你分可真多啊,刚才刚问了个,现在又问!
你用这个试试:
ComboBox1.Items.AddString()
 
var
c:Integer;
begin
Randomize;
c := Random(5);
ComboBox1.ItemIndex := c;
end;
 
to:hhjjhhjj
I 的值始终=-1,
还有什么办法啊?
 
那是应为item里没有4
 
lngdtommy 做得是对的
 
var
c:Integer;
begin
Randomize;
c := Random(5);
ComboBox1.Items.AddString('c')
end;
 
这个问题很简单,大家都说完了
个人认为 hhjjhhjj的答案比较好
 
后退
顶部